Expedition Everest (coolest ride EVER!!) had closed down one night because of a heavy rain, but a nice cast member let me in to walk around in the queue. The area I am standing in is only opened during really long lines….else it’s closed off. It’s pretty amazing the detail that the Disney folks put in to these waiting areas. I found out later that Disney sent a team of people to Nepal to study and and bring back artifacts that would make riders feel like they were checking in to an Everest base camp before going in to the mountain. The Yeti was even designed based on conversations that they had had with some of the natives. For me, I just get a kick out of watching my youngest daughter giggle as we ride it…
